Cooler is made in Vietnam. Appears solid and is heavy, even when empty. One hinge pin was forced into a slightly out of line hole on the lid distorting the hole. It's plastic so came with scrapes that made it look used. Arctic Zone recently changed the design of their lid latches away from rubber so I'm not sure how long these rubber ones will last. Good thing it has a 5 year warranty. I primarily bought this to secure food outdoors from animals and it looks like it'll do the job.
